LONDON, Feb 9 (Reuters) - British IT company Micro Focus
International re-instated its dividend on Tuesday after
it made "solid progress" in the first year of its three-year
turnaround plan.
The company reported adjusted core earnings of $1.2 billion,
down from $1.4 billion a year earlier, at margin of 39.1%, which
it said was towards the upper end of expectations. Revenue
declined 10% to $3 billion.
It said it would reinstate its final dividend at 15.5 cents
per share.
